Emile Julien Deuss

April 28, 2004

Emile Julien Deuss, 85, of 5 Wallace Place died Wednesday at Berkshire Medical Center.

Born in Charleroi, Belgium, on July 7, 1918, son of Leon and Coralie Dumery Deuss, he was educated there and graduated from the naval academy in Belgium.

After immigrating to the United States, he joined the Merchant Marine and served during World War II.

Mr. Deuss was a self-employed painter for 30 years. Before that, he worked as a painter in the maintenance department at the former St. Luke's Hospital and for area contractors.

He was a communicant of St. Joseph's Church and a member of the Ralph J. Froio Senior Center and the Lt. John N. Truden Veterans of Foreign Wars Post 448.

His wife, the former Anne A. Dion, whom he married Sept. 10, 1945, died Sept. 15, 2000.

He leaves a son, Jeffrey M. Deuss of Lawville, N.Y.; a brother, Charles Deuss of Dusseldorf, Germany, and two grandchildren. An infant son, Gerard Deuss, died in 1946.
